Хабр Курсы для всех
РЕКЛАМА
Практикум, Хекслет, SkyPro, авторские курсы — собрали всех и попросили скидки. Осталось выбрать!
$ sudo echo '<?php phpinfo(); ?>' > /var/www/phpinfo.php
bash: /var/www/phpinfo.php: Отказано в доступеНе смотря на InDesign, вёрстка ужасна. Подписей под рисунками нет, только надпись, двоеточие, рисунок. Некоторые рисунки уехали на следующую страницу после надписи. Библиография («Пригодилось») вообще не читабельна, даже просто с маркерами списка смотрелось бы лучше (я даже не говорю про ГОСТ). В командах и листинках «программистские» одинарные и двойные кавычки заменены на лапки, что мешает копипасту. Листинги набраны пропорциональным шрифтом. А если уж говорить про кавычки, то везде использованы разные — где-то лапки, где-то ёлочки.Благодарю, учту.
Про команды отдельная история. Судя по всему, автор не все команды сам пробовал набирать. Пруф (стр. 23):
$ sudo echo '<?php phpinfo(); ?>' > /var/www/phpinfo.php
bash: /var/www/phpinfo.php: Отказано в доступе

Но в общем руководство и не претендует, сразу написано «научимся работать в терминале, выучим несколько полезных команд», что следует понимать буквально — научимся набивать заученные команды в терминал. Объяснения команд кроме однострочных описаний cd, ls, mv, cp и копипаста из Википедии про sudo нет.Правильно, это не полноценное описание работы в ОС, не учебник — это большой шаг к изучению Linux. Официальный мануал указан: debian.org.
Всё, что написано в руководстве было протестировано, я бы даже сказал, мануал писался с параллельно выполняемыми действиям (собственно есть и скриншоты).
sudo echo 'hello' > /bin/ZZZустановка Apache2, MySQL, PHP5;
установка дополнительных модулей и библиотек;
установка Pecl APC;
компилирование PHP с GD;
Зачем в дебиане качать .deb пакеты? Есть же шикарный репозиторий.Вы считаете, что пользователь, пришедший с MS Windows сразу полезет в репозитории? Если вы заметили, в тексте есть несколько вариантов установки, в том числе, и из репозиториев.
Про самбу лучше бы вообще не писалиДля домашней сети описанная установка то, что требуется.
Управлять сайтами от одного пользователя — огроменная дыра в безопасностиДа, если сервер стоит в стойке, а тут речь о домашнем компьютере.
Почта. По умолчанию она стоит и не работает.Почта отправляется, принимается, лежит здесь: /var/spool/mail
Web-сервер на Debian GNU/Linux для начинающих